Suspended for absence, was SHO Vijaypur in court at 6 in morning?

Sumit Sharma. Updated: 5/25/2019 11:11:35 AM

JAMMU: Station House Officer (SHO) Vijaypur Rakesh Bamba was placed under suspension after he was found absent from the station in a surprise inspection carried out at 6 am on Friday morning by Deputy Inspector of General (DIG) Jammu-Kathua range Sujit Kumar.

Oblivious to his suspension, the officer came to know of his action four hours later inside a court premise, carrying a case dairy of FIR NO 49/2017 before court, as directed by DIG Kumar, himself.

DIG Kumar suspended Inspector Bamba for his unauthorized absence from the police station Vijaypur and insufficient preparedness to thwart untoward incidents, official sources informed.

The DIG has directed SSP Kathua Shridhar Patil to hold enquiry against the delinquent police officer, they added.

The action on the part of DIG was taken after he paid surprise visit to the police station at 6’o clock in the morning.

“On the basis of the inputs that some untoward incident may take place in police stations along the National Highway, I paid surprise visit to check the alertness and security aspects of Police Stations in district Samba in the early hours and found SHO Vijaypur Rakesh Bamba absent from his duties following which action has been taken against him”, DIG Kumar informed The News Now.

Official sources said that DIG during checking found that the Sentry was deployed without wearing Bullet Proof (BP) jacket and Patka at the main entry gate of Police Station Vijaypur and videography of the same was recorded by him on the spot.

“DIG also observed that the Daily Diary on the CCTN Portal was found pending and last maintained on previous day on 23rd, May 2019. Inspector Rakesh Bamba, SHO Police Station Vijaypur was absent and there was no entry regarding his movement in the daily diary,” sources said.

“The Munshi of police station Vijaypur was unable to produce record of other movement order, wireless message,” they added.

On this grave negligence on the part of security lapse of Police Station Vijaypur and carelessness and indiscipline on the part of duty of SHO, DIG placed him under suspension.

He was directed to deposit uniform articles in equipment store DPL Samba while Shridhar Patil, SSP Kathua, was asked to hold a departmental enquiry against delinquent officer and submit his finding to the Zonal Police Headquarters with specific recommendation within 15 days.

Meanwhile, whispering started within police circle as it was claimed that the mobile phone of the SHO Bamba was out of network coverage even though many attempts were made by his subordinates to inform him about the action against him.

“It was only at 10 am Inspector Bamba came to know about the incident. Bamba was in court premises with a case dairy of FIR NO 49/2017 to be produced before court on direction of DIG concerned when he got information about his suspension,” sources said.
Meanwhile, DIG Sujit Kumar when apprised of the matter, said, “I paid visit to police station early morning. Which court turns up at 6 o’clock in morning?”
